EXCLUSIVE: Pray For Me: Pope Francis’ Story, a feature documentary about the former Pope, developed in collaboration with the Vatican Television Center, has locked sales deals in Spain and Portugal out of the Cannes Market.
NOS Lusomundo has acquired rights for Portugal, while A Contracorriente Films has secured Spain.
The film is directed by Facundo Bartucci and co-produced with Facundo Mugica. Matías Fontenla serves as Executive Producer and international sales agent.
Edited by Miguel De Zuviría (Trenque Lauquen), the documentary traces Jorge Bergoglio’s journey from Buenos Aires to becoming the first Latin American Pope.
“This is a project where access, story, and timing align in a very powerful way,” Fontenla, a former exec at the Argentinian-based FilmSharks, said in a statement. “The goal is to position the film as a global event, both theatrically and across platforms.”
